Installing or removing saw blade

CAUTION:
*Always be sure that the tool is switched off and the battery cartridge is removed before
installing or removing the blade.
*Use only the Makita socket wrench provided to install or remove the blade. Failure to do
so
may result in overtightening or insufficient tightening of the hex bolt. This could cause
serious injury to operator or others in the general vicinity of the tool.
Lock the handle in the raised position by
pushing in the stopper pin.
To
remove the blade, use the socket
wrench to loosen the hex bolt holding the
center cover by turning
it
counterclockwise.
Raise the safety cover and center cover.
Press the shaft lock to lock the spindle and
use the socket wrench to loosen the hex
bolt (left-handed) clockwise. Then remove
the hex
bolt, outer flange and blade.
